As I am on the lookout for my first trad bow I was wondering what draw length I should be looking for. My compound has a 30 inch draw length but all the trad bows that i look to buy seem to always have 50# at 28 inch or 60# at 28etc...
Is it that trad bows are measured for their poundage at 28 inches and then if you pull it back further you get more. I'd like to know as I really want nothing more than 55# of weight. Thanks.

Yer mate unless made otherwise to order most bows are measured at 28" and yes if you draw longer you may gain as much as 3-5 pound per inch depending on how much the bow stacks at the end of the draw.A 30 inch compound draw length would normaly come back an inch or so with a trad bow though so it prob wont be that big a problem.I would order a 55 and be done with it as the variance in bow scales around the place can easy be 3 pound anyway so go with the 55 and just enjoy shooting it.
